Akufo-Addo To Ghanaians: Don’t Talk Down The Cedi

Spread the love

President Akufo-Addo has urged Ghanaians not to talk down on the country’s currency – the Ghana cedi.

Addressing the nation on the economy on Sunday (30 October), President Akufo-Addo said, “Money doesn’t like noise. If you talk down you currency, it will go down, if you allow others to talk down your currency it will go down.”

“All of us have a role to play in strengthening the cedi, stop speculation. Those who publish falsehood resulting in panic, the relevant state agencies will act against such person.”

He has, therefore, assured Ghanaians that the government is working around the clock to get the economy back in shape,

He said his government remains committed to implementing measures to address the perennial depreciation of the Ghana cedi against its major trading partners

“We are determined to restore stability in the economy,” President Akufo-Addo said.
